### Is your feature request related to a problem? Please describe.
With the `awkward` library (https://github.com/scikit-hep/awkward), we are attempting to validate operations with the `cuda` backend against the same operations with the `cpu` backend.
@ianna and I have noticed that in some cases, there appear to be differences in precision between CPU and GPU, as documented here: https://github.com/scikit-hep/awkward/issues/3711
These differences can make validation difficult.
### Describe the solution you'd like
We would like an option to retain more precision in the GPU computations (even if this means the computation is slower), to facilitate validation against CPU operations.
